Where do SEO and AI search fit?
Search is one possible investment within the growth plan. It is worth pursuing when buyers ask questions that connect to your product and the company has a useful, credible answer. I can help assess that opportunity and define what a useful test would show. Page-level planning and production need their own agreed scope if we choose to pursue them.
For AI search, the aim is to make the offer and evidence easy to find, understand, and cite. We separate accurate answers and citations from visits, qualified inquiries, and revenue. A citation alone does not establish that the work is bringing customers.

What if we do not have reliable measurement yet?
We identify what can be learned from the available evidence and which decisions require better measurement. I can define the events, reporting requirements, and owners needed for the plan. We do not treat a measurement specification as a completed implementation.
What happens if a test does not work?
We review the result against the question the test was meant to answer. The next decision may be to change the audience or offer, fix the buying path, run a better test, or stop funding that approach. No engagement guarantees traffic, pipeline, or a particular growth rate.
